Default Under drive pulley

If you have a underdrive pulley on the balancer will that rob boost from a procharger? Maybe a stupid question? I just don't want to do anything to take away from the boost.

Yes, an underdrive crank pulley will reduce the speed of the SC. But, you can compensate by using a smaller pulley on the SC.
